项目规划与设计
为了确保我们的目标用户群体能够享受高质量的游戏体验,首先必须明确他们是谁以及他们的喜好是什么,对于“三打一”类型的策略游戏,我们期望的目标受众是对策略性和复杂性较强的玩家群体。
在设计阶段,我们需要精心考量以下几个要素:
- 游戏的玩法:确保每个细节都符合玩家的心理预期。
- 界面布局:简洁而直观,易于导航。
- 规则说明:清晰明了,避免任何误解。
选择合适的技术栈也是开发成功的重要因素之一,对于棋牌类游戏,常用的前端框架包括 React 或 Vue,后端可以选择 Node.js 或 Django 的 Djanog,数据库方面建议 MySQL 或 MongoDB,这些技术栈的选择应当基于项目的具体需求和团队的专业技能。
技术选型
前端开发
前端主要负责UI/UX的设计和实现,使用 HTML、CSS 和 JavaScript 构建基本的网页结构,并通过 AJAX 进行前后端的数据交互,特别注意用户体验和页面加载速度,以便为用户提供流畅的服务。
后端开发
后端主要涉及逻辑处理、API 接口和服务端功能,使用 Node.js 可以轻松搭建服务器环境,并利用 Express 框架简化 HTTP 请求处理,确保系统的安全性与稳定性,需要配置防火墙并实施加密措施。
数据库设计与管理
数据库的设计需要根据业务需求确定表结构和索引设置,掌握 SQL 是必需的,重视性能优化,例如创建合适的索引来提升读取速度。
开发流程
前端开发
前端主要负责 UI/UX 设计和实现,使用 HTML、CSS 和 JavaScript 构建基本的网页结构,并通过 AJAX 进行前后端的数据交互,特别注意用户体验和页面加载速度,以便为用户提供流畅的服务。
后端开发
后端主要涉及逻辑处理、API 接口和服务端功能,使用 Node.js 可以轻松搭建服务器环境,并利用 Express 框架简化 HTTP 请求处理,确保系统的安全性与稳定性,需要配置防火墙并实施加密措施。
数据库设计与管理
数据库的设计需要根据业务需求确定表结构和索引设置,掌握 SQL 是必需的,重视性能优化,例如创建合适的索引来提升读取速度。
测试与调试
测试环节包括单元测试、集成测试和系统测试,旨在发现并修复潜在问题,重点关注各种边界条件和异常情况,确保游戏运行稳定可靠。
部署上线
最后一步是将游戏部署到服务器上,迎接广大用户的挑战,在此阶段,需关注服务器资源分配、备份机制和监控指标,以确保游戏能在不同网络环境下正常运行。
市场推广与运营
完成以上步骤后,下一步就是进入市场推广和运营阶段,这可能包括社交媒体营销、合作推广、线下活动等多种渠道,关键在于了解目标用户的需求和偏好,针对这些需求制定有效的宣传策略,并建立完善的客服体系和反馈机制,及时解决用户的问题,提升用户体验。
希望这篇文章能帮助您更好地理解如何规划和开发一个成功的“三打一”棋牌游戏项目,祝您的游戏开发之路充满挑战与乐趣,最终获得成功!
版权声明
本文仅代表作者观点,不代表百度立场。
本文系作者授权百度百家发表,未经许可,不得转载。
发表评论